Transaction 67892d79e5968dc002e0e973afcb4f6d0c1f1d4afc4eba75e6240ea127effe33
1 Input
1 Output
-
67892d79e5968dc002e0e973afcb4f6d0c1f1d4afc4eba75e6240ea127effe33:0
- value
- 2504470
- script pubkey
- OP_0 OP_PUSHBYTES_20 246ba7a2c1c8811e2991bf5896122b4954d7b155
- address
- bc1qy3460gkpezq3u2v3havfvy3tf92d0v24ldza75